The Beagle's Scent-Hound Story Begins in Great Britain

The Beagle originated in Great Britain and belongs to the small scent hounds. Its original task was primarily to follow the scent of hare. Beagles traditionally worked in packs, so stamina, attentiveness and coordination with other dogs all played an important role. This history helps explain why the breed is still closely associated with scent work, movement and company. A real Beagle can focus intensely on an interesting smell and explore its surroundings with remarkable persistence. At the same time, it is regarded as a sociable dog that values contact with people and other dogs. This background offers more than an attractive setting for a Plush Toy interpretation. The keen nose represents curiosity, the pack tradition suggests community, and the compact body reflects active mobility. Floppy Ears, a Compact Build and an Alert Gaze Define the Breed

The breed standard describes the Beagle as a sturdy, compactly built scent hound that should show quality without coarseness. Particularly distinctive are the long, low-set ears with rounded tips, which hang closely beside the cheeks. The eyes may be dark brown or hazel and make an important contribution to the attentive face. A strong muzzle, firm feet and a high-set tail carried with energy without curling over the back complete the outline. The short, dense coat appears in several recognised hound colours. The familiar tricolour pattern is especially well known, although Beagles may display other accepted combinations. Did you know...

The Beagle belongs to the small scent hounds and originated in Great Britain. Its traditional task was primarily to follow the scent of hare. Beagles were bred to work in packs and are therefore regarded as highly sociable. Typical breed features include long, low-set ears with rounded tips and a high-set tail carried with energy. The coat is short, dense and weatherproof; alongside the familiar tricolour pattern, several other hound colours are recognised, and the tip of the tail is white.
